The AF Evans/Mercy Housing partnership is planning to build a residential development on the six-acre site that will include a mix of market-rate and affordable apartments over ground-floor retail and commercial space that will blend in with the surrounding community. The estimated cost of the project was not disclosed. It is expected that UC will retain land ownership of the site and receive ground rent payments from the development team.

The site is bounded by at Laguna, Haight, Buchanan and Hermann streets. The partnership has hired the architectural firm of Van Meter Williams & Pollack to design the master plan for the development. The number of units to be constructed and the cost of development have not yet been determined. Groundbreaking is anticipated in 2006.

The Sisters of Mercy established the non-profit Mercy Housing in 1981 to respond to the affordable housing crisis across the country. Mercy Housing has collaborated with dozens of public agencies and the private sector to build more than 15,000 housing units in 14 states, including 1,800 units in San Francisco.

Locally based AF Evans Development, a subsidiary of Oakland-based AF Evans Co., has overseen the development of affordable housing, assisted-living facilities, market-rate apartments and condominiums. Established in 1977, AF Evans has completed over 7,600 residential units in California, Nevada and Washington, including 1,530 units in San Francisco. AF Evans and Mercy Housing have jointly developed four affordable housing properties in the city.
